April 2007, Minneapolis, USA...Omnetics, the leading manufacturer of miniature high rel connectors, is now delivering its ultra-reliable, lightweight circular interconnect solutions to the medical industry. Featuring Omnetics' patented Nano Flex Pin contacts, connectors are finding applications in human-interface systems, and are available with custom cables and jackets to allow disinfection and reuse as needed.

Providing levels of quality and reliability first demanded by military systems, Omnetics' circular inserts are often molded directly into medical equipment handles or instruments, forming an integral part of the designer's product. A range of standard sizes including some off-the-shelf parts allow quick evaluation and prototype development.

Omnetics built-In circular designs are available in three different diameters and offer up to 27 positions in mated pairs on a .050" pitch. Standard wiring includes Teflon-insulated 26 gauge stranded wire to achieve maximum cable flexibility. Solder cup connector shells are also available. Custom wire and mechanical assemblies are readily available.

Specific medical applications include catheters, sensors and stimulators.

About Omnetics

Omnetics was formed in 1984 to deliver rugged, reliable interconnect solutions for the most demanding industries. The company has a fully integrated design and manufacturing plant in Minneapolis, Minnesota USA, where it produces Micro and Nano miniature interconnect products, featuring COTS, Standards and Custom connectors for industries such as Military, Aerospace, Defence, Medical and other technology oriented OEMs.
